PUBLIC HEARING
The Town of Mountain View will hold a Public Hearing on February 5, 2019 at 7:00 p.m. at Mountain View Town Hall, 405 Highway 414, to receive public input on Ordinance 2019-1, An Ordinance Amending the Prohibition on Annoying, Obscene and Threatening Communication.

MINUTES
TOWN OF MOUNTAIN VIEW
JANUARY 2, 2019 7:00 P.M.
The January 2, 2018 Mountain View Town Council meeting was called to order at 7:00 p.m. by Mayor Scott Dellinger. Those present were Council President, Gina Tims and Council members, Tori Carter, Bryan Ayres and Jacob Porter, Clerk, Penny Robbins and Chief of Police, Brian Sparks.
Oath of Office was administered by Mayor Scott Dellinger to newly elected officials Bryan Ayres and Jacob Porter.
Motion by Gina Tims, second by Tori Carter to approve the agenda; motion carried.
Motion by Bryan Ayres, second by Jacob Porter to approve the December 18, 2018 minutes as presented; motion carried.
Mayor Dellinger announced his appointment of officials for council approval. Motion by Tori Carter, second by Bryan Ayres to the appointments of Clerk
Treasurer, Penny Robbins, Chief of Police, Brian Sparks and Municipal Judge, Mark Harris; motion carried.
Mayor Dellinger announced his board appointment for the next two years. Motion by Jacob Porter, second by Bryan Ayres to approve the following appointments, Bridger Valley Joint Powers Board, Gina Tims and Owen Peterson, Uinta County Joint Powers Fire Board, Bryan Ayres, Lincoln Uinta Revolving Loan Fund, Lewis Thomas, Uinta County Economic Development Board, Vacant and The Greater Bridger Valley Chamber of Commerce, Cindy Haggit; motion carried.
Motion by Tori Carter, second by Jacob Porter to move Financial Statement Disclosures to record; motion carried.
Motion by Bryan Ayres, second by Jacob Porter to pay the following bills; Brenntag Pacific Inc, Chemicals, $1379.50, Chemtech-Ford, Sewer Analysis, $296.00, Mountain View High School, Christmas Window, Ellingford Brothers Inc, Department Supplies, $1338.03, Fastenal, Shop, $264.12, Long Reimer Winegar Beppler, Attorney Fees, Dominion Energy, Gas Service, $609.05,Sam’s, Membership fee, $100.00, SOS Technologies, Oxygen Equipment Service, $333.00, The O.P. Dealer, Office Supplies, $88.60, Uinta county Clerk, Title Fee, $15.00, Union Telephone Co, Phone Service, $885.20, WEX Bank, Fuel, $1413.00, WAM, Winter Workshop Registration, $450.00, WY Department of Transportation, Vehicle License Fee, $5.00; motion carried.
In other business, Mayor Scott Dellinger administered the oath to Jason Forsgren with the Lyman police department to assist the Mountain View officers in an emergency.
There being no more business to come before the town council, the meeting was adjourned at 7:07 p.m.

TOWN OF LYMAN WYOMING
Minutes of the Business Meeting held January 3, 2019
Present were Mayor Berg, Councilmembers Andy Spray, Shane Hooton, Tansy Shelton and Dallas Sill, Public Works Director Jared Crane, Clerk Lisa Bradshaw, Chief Kathy Adams and Attorney Thayne Peterson.
Councilman Hooton made a motion to approve the agenda as amended, second by Councilman Spray, motion carried unanimously.
Councilman Spray made a motion to approve the minutes of the December 20, 2018 business meeting and work session, second by Councilman Sill, motion carried unanimously.
RESOLUTION # 2019-01 A RESOLUTION AUTHORIZING AND DESIGNATING SIGNATORIES FOR THE TOWN OF LYMAN ACCOUNTS. Councilwoman Shelton made a motion to approve Resolution # 2019-01, second by Councilman Sill, motion carried unanimously.
RESOLUTION # 2019-02 A RESOLUTION DESIGNATING 1ST BANK AS A DEPOSITORY BANK FOR BASIC MUNICIPAL ACCOUNTS OF THE TOWN OF LYMAN, WYOMING. Councilman Sill made a motion to approve Resolution # 2019-02, second by Councilwoman Shelton, motion carried unanimously.
RESOLUTION # 2019-03 A RESOLUTION DESIGNATING THE BRIDGER VALLEY PIONEER NEWSPAPER AS THE OFFICIAL DESIGNATED NEWSPAPER FOR THE TOWN OF LYMAN, WYOMING TO PUBLISH LEGAL NOTICES, ADVERTISE FOR BIDS, PRINT MINUTES OF OFFICIAL MEETING, AND TO PUBLISH ORDINANCES AND OTHER DOCUMENTS AS MAY BE REQUIRED BY LAW. Councilman Spray made a motion to approve Resolution # 2019-03, second by Councilwoman Shelton, motion carried unanimously.
Councilman Sill made a motion to approve the following bills: Alsco – janitorial supplies $216.84, Biolynceus Bilolgical Solution – probiotic scrubber $2,642.72, BCBS – insurance $14,347.33, Robin Sinnett – contract labor $1,200.00, Brenntag Pacific Inc. – chemicals $543.32, Dearborn National Life Insurance Company – insurance $2.96, Wyoming Worker’s Compensation – monthly workers comp. $1,272.13, Fastenal Industrial – supplies $98.40, Grainger – supplies $469.80, Harris Law Office – judge contract $1,200.00, Hartford Priority – benefits $252.35, Ricoh USA Inc. – copier contracts $196.79, Mailfinance – postage machine lease $255.81, Great West Trust Company – 457 retirement $900.00, Peterson Legal Services – attorney contract $3,000.00, Postmaster – utility bills $214.97, Uinta County Public Health – vaccinations $40.00, Dominion Energy – utility bill $2,504.76, Toms HVAC – heritage house HVAC upgrade $9,790.00, Uinta Engineering – building inspections $225.00, Wyoming Department of Workforce – quarterly payment $131.85, Wyoming Retirement – retirement $7,866.35, Lacey Maxfield – contract labor $200.00, second by Councilman Spray, motion carried unanimously.
Councilman Hooton made a motion to adjourn, second by Councilwoman Shelton, motion carried unanimously.
